Cross-agent memory bridge for AI coding assistants. Persistent knowledge graph shared across 10 IDEs (Cursor, Windsurf, Claude Code, Codex, Copilot, Kiro, Antigravity, OpenCode, Trae, Gemini CLI) via MCP. 22 tools including team collaboration, auto-cleanup, mini-skills, session management, and workspace sync. 100% local, zero API keys required.
memorix is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server published by AVIDS2. It ranks #1105 of 58,900 servers tracked on MCP Toplist, and its repository has 498 GitHub stars. memorix is listed on Glama, and ships as a single rolling release with no explicit version metadata. It was first listed on Mar 9, 2026.
